KeePass2와 KeePassX, 어느 것이 더 안전합니까?

KeePass2와 KeePassX, 어느 것이 더 안전합니까?

Windows에서는 KeePass2를 사용하고 Linux에서는 KeePassX를 사용합니다. 나는 데이터베이스 호환성과 크로스 플랫폼 성능에 대한 두 가지 주장을 이해합니다. 내가 궁금한 것은 둘 중 하나가 어느 정도 안전한지 여부입니다.

다음 예에서는 Ubuntu 리포지토리에서 직접 다운로드한 KeePass2 및 KeePassX를 실행하고 있습니다.

KeePassX를 사용하여 비밀번호를 생성하고 두 프로그램의 가짜 항목에 붙여넣었습니다. 비밀번호 보안에 대한 다양한 평가를 확인하세요.

KeePassX:

KeePassX:112비트

KeePass2:

KeePass2: 75비트

다음으로 키보드 키 몇 개를 빠르게 으깨서 직접 비밀번호를 만들었습니다. 이전과 마찬가지로 KeePassX는 KeePass2보다 더 높은 수를 반환합니다(거의 항상 그렇듯이).

KeePassX:

KeePassX: 56비트

KeePass2:

KeePass2: 30비트

어느 것이 맞나요? 두 프로그램이 보안을 결정하기 위해 서로 다른 알고리즘을 사용하고 있습니까? 어느 것이 더 신뢰할 수 있습니까?

또한 두 프로그램이 데이터베이스에 서로 다른 암호화 방법을 사용합니까? 둘 중 하나가 더 안전합니까?

관련 정보